| To celebrate National Banana Bread Day, we offer you two recipes:- Peanut Butter Banana Bread from our friends at P.B. Loco
- Chocolate Chip Banana Bread from acclaimed pastry chef Pichet Ong, formerly of the Jean Georges Vongerichten empire and now proprietor of P*ONG in New York CityThe one tip we can give when making banana bread is: use very ripe bananas. If your bananas are overripe, don’t thrown them out—make banana bread (or banana daiquiris). And if you’re making the chocolate chip recipe, buy the best-quality chocolate chips you can find. |
